Redox Indicators A redox indicator should be such that it produces a sudden change in the electrode potential in the vicinity of the equivalence point during a redox titration. EXPERIMENT 7 REDOX TITRATION BACHELOR OF SCIENCE (HONS) CHEMISTRY AND … The indicators used in redox … Oxalic acid, Mohr’s salt and arsenious oxide are reducing agents commonly used in redox titrations. Titrations involving iodine have evolved for the analysis of a number of oxidizing and reducing agents. The lack of a good method of end point detection makes direct titration of oxidizing agents by solutions of iodide salts impractical. A common example is the redox titration of a standardized solution of potassium permanganate (KMnO4) against an analyte containing an unknown concentration of iron (II) ions (Fe2+).
